总结前端开发亮点项目时,应突出项目目标、关键技术、挑战解决方案、项目成果、个人贡献等几个方面。例如,在项目中使用了最新的框架如React或Vue.js,解决了性能优化的挑战,并且通过严格的代码审查和测试,最终大幅度提升了用户体验和系统稳定性。以下为详细的总结方法和示例:
一、项目目标
任何一个项目都有其明确的目标,这些目标可以是功能性的,也可以是非功能性的。功能性的目标如实现特定的用户界面或业务逻辑,非功能性的目标如提高系统性能或增强用户体验。明确的项目目标是项目成功的基石。项目目标的设定不仅仅是为了指导开发过程,更是为了在项目结束后进行效果评估。
例如,一个项目的目标可能是“开发一个响应式的电商网站,使得用户在任何设备上都能流畅购物”。这个目标中包含了功能性目标(开发电商网站)和非功能性目标(响应式设计)。
二、关键技术
在前端开发中,技术的选择和应用是项目成败的重要因素之一。关键技术包括但不限于前端框架(如React、Vue.js、Angular)、构建工具(如Webpack、Gulp)、CSS预处理器(如Sass、Less)、以及各类第三方库和插件。使用最新的技术不仅可以提高开发效率,还能提升项目的整体质量。
例如,在一个复杂的单页应用项目中,使用React和Redux来管理应用状态,通过Webpack进行打包和优化,使用Sass进行样式管理。这些技术的合理组合可以使项目更具扩展性和维护性。
三、挑战解决方案
在项目开发过程中,挑战是不可避免的。如何识别、分析并解决这些挑战,是项目成功的关键。在总结时,可以详细描述遇到的主要挑战和解决方案。解决方案的详细描述不仅展示了技术能力,还能反映出问题解决的思路和方法。
例如,在一个实时数据展示的项目中,遇到了数据同步和性能优化的挑战。通过使用WebSocket实现实时数据传输,采用虚拟DOM技术减少不必要的渲染,从而解决了性能问题,确保了数据的实时性和系统的高效运行。
四、项目成果
项目成果是对项目目标的实现情况进行总结和展示。成果可以是量化的(如性能提升了30%、用户留存率提高了20%),也可以是质化的(如用户反馈良好、系统稳定性增强)。项目成果的展示不仅是对工作的肯定,也是对未来工作的指导。
例如,通过优化电商网站的响应速度,使得页面加载时间从5秒减少到2秒,用户的购物体验显著提升,用户留存率提高了15%。这些具体的成果数据,可以清晰地展示项目的成功与价值。
五、个人贡献
在团队项目中,个人的贡献同样重要。在总结时,要具体描述自己在项目中的角色和职责,以及所完成的具体任务和取得的成果。个人贡献的描述不仅展示了个人能力,也能为未来的职业发展提供有力的证明。
例如,在一个团队开发的社交媒体平台项目中,负责了前端架构设计和主要功能模块的开发,通过代码审查和单元测试,确保了代码质量。最终,项目按时交付并得到了用户的高度评价。
六、经验教训
每个项目都会有成功的经验和失败的教训。总结这些经验教训,可以为未来的项目提供宝贵的参考。不断总结和反思,是提升个人和团队能力的重要途径。
例如,在一个项目中,由于前期需求不明确,导致开发过程中频繁修改,影响了进度。通过这个教训,认识到需求分析的重要性,在后续项目中加强了需求沟通和文档化工作,显著提高了项目的顺利进行。
七、未来展望
对未来的展望可以是对技术趋势的预测,也可以是对个人或团队发展的规划。明确的未来展望,可以为接下来的工作提供方向和动力。
例如,随着前端技术的不断发展,计划深入学习和应用新的技术,如Server-Side Rendering(SSR)和Progressive Web App(PWA),以提升开发效率和用户体验。同时,计划参与更多的开源项目,提升个人技术水平和行业影响力。
以上为前端开发亮点项目总结的详细方法和示例。通过明确项目目标、关键技术、挑战解决方案、项目成果、个人贡献、经验教训和未来展望,可以全面展示项目的成功与价值,为未来的工作提供有力的指导和支持。
相关问答FAQs:
FAQs
前端开发亮点项目总结应该包含哪些要素?
在撰写前端开发亮点项目总结时,首先要明确项目的基本信息,包括项目名称、时间、团队成员及角色等。接着,可以详细描述项目的目标和需求,阐明项目背景及其重要性。接下来,重点突出项目中的技术栈,说明使用的框架、库及工具,例如 React、Vue、Angular 等。同时,讨论在开发过程中遇到的挑战及解决方案,这不仅展示了技术能力,也体现了团队的协作精神。此外,可以提及用户体验的优化措施,以及项目上线后的反馈与数据分析,最后总结项目的收获与未来的改进方向。
如何有效展示项目中的技术栈和工具选择?
在展示项目的技术栈和工具选择时,可以采用表格或图示的方式,将各个技术及其用途一一列出。对于每种技术,可以简单说明其优势及为何选择它。例如,如果使用了 React,可以提到其组件化开发的优点,如何提高了代码的可复用性和维护性。对于工具,说明其在项目中的具体应用,例如使用 Webpack 进行打包,如何优化了资源加载时间。通过这些详细的说明,可以让读者更清晰地了解技术选择的背后逻辑,同时也能展示开发者的技术深度与广度。
在项目总结中如何体现团队协作和个人贡献?
在项目总结中体现团队协作和个人贡献,可以通过具体的案例来展示。例如,可以描述某个关键功能的开发过程中,团队成员之间的沟通和协作是如何进行的,使用了哪些工具(如 Git、JIRA 等)来管理任务和进度。同时,个人贡献的部分可以通过列举自己负责的功能模块,或是特定的技术难题的解决方案来体现。在表达时,可以强调团队合作的重要性,例如通过集体讨论来得到更好的设计方案,或者通过代码审核提升代码质量。这样不仅能够展现个人的能力,也能彰显团队的力量。
前端开发亮点项目总结的详细解析
一、项目概述
在开始项目总结之前,撰写一段简洁明了的项目概述是必要的。项目概述应包含项目名称、开发周期、团队成员以及项目的核心目标。描述项目的背景及其业务价值,帮助读者迅速理解该项目的意义。
二、项目目标和需求
明确项目目标和需求是撰写总结的关键部分。此部分可以通过以下几个方面进行描述:
- 用户需求:列出项目所要解决的具体问题,目标用户群体是谁,用户在使用过程中遇到了哪些痛点。
- 商业目标:项目希望达成的商业目标,例如增加用户留存率、提升转化率等。
- 功能需求:具体的功能需求清单,明确哪些功能是核心,哪些是附加功能。
三、技术栈与工具
详细阐述项目所使用的技术栈和工具,能够帮助读者更好地理解项目的技术背景。在此部分,可以考虑以下内容:
- 框架和库:选择的前端框架(如 React、Vue、Angular)及其原因,使用的主要库(如 Redux、Axios)和它们的作用。
- 开发工具:开发过程中使用的工具,比如代码编辑器、版本控制工具、构建工具等,解释它们在项目中的重要性。
- 其他技术:如 CSS 预处理器(Sass、Less)、自动化测试工具(Jest、Mocha)等,解释其带来的效益。
四、开发过程中的挑战与解决方案
在项目开发过程中,几乎总会遇到各种挑战,记录这些挑战及解决方案不仅能展示技术能力,还能体现开发者的应变能力。可以考虑以下内容:
- 技术难题:描述在某个功能实现中遇到的技术难题,以及最终如何解决的。
- 团队协作:若团队在沟通上遇到问题,如何通过有效的工具或方法改善了沟通效率。
- 时间管理:如何在时间紧迫的情况下合理安排开发进度,保证项目按时上线。
五、用户体验优化
用户体验是前端开发中至关重要的一环。在这一部分,可以描述在项目中如何进行用户体验的优化,比如:
- UI 设计:如何与设计师合作,确保界面的美观与易用性。
- 性能优化:在项目中采取了哪些措施来优化性能,比如懒加载、代码分割等。
- 用户反馈:上线后如何收集用户反馈,并根据反馈进行迭代与改进。
六、项目上线后的反馈与数据分析
项目上线后,收集用户反馈和数据分析是评估项目成功与否的重要步骤。在此部分,可以包括:
- 用户反馈:收集到的用户评价、建议及改进意见。
- 数据分析:通过分析用户使用数据,判断项目的成功与否,比如用户留存率、活跃度等关键指标。
- 改进方向:根据反馈和数据分析,明确未来的改进方向,为后续版本规划提供依据。
七、总结与反思
在项目总结的最后一部分,进行整体的总结与反思是非常重要的。可以考虑:
- 项目收获:总结在项目中获得的技能与经验,如何提升了自身的技术能力。
- 团队合作:反思团队合作中有哪些成功之处,哪些地方还有待改进。
- 未来展望:对项目的未来发展做出展望,可能的扩展功能或改进方向。
八、附录
附录部分可以包括项目相关的链接,如 GitHub 代码仓库、线上demo、相关文档等,便于读者进一步了解项目。
通过这样详细的结构,前端开发亮点项目总结将不仅能展示项目的成就,还能体现开发者的专业能力与团队协作精神。撰写总结的过程中,时刻保持清晰、简洁的表达,以确保读者能够轻松理解项目的各个方面。
原创文章,作者:DevSecOps,如若转载,请注明出处:https://devops.gitlab.cn/archives/169244